Didn't File Taxes — further steps and repercussions?

285 views 1 replies

If I didn’t file or pay taxes two years ago, what are the possible repercussions? My main concern is persecution/legal action.

Does the IT department first have to send a notice to file and pay (with the accrued interest + fine etc) and can only persecute if there is no action or response from recipient? Or can they directly take legal action against me without any notice? Is there anything I can do now to remedy this situation?

Replies (1)
Sir
you can voluntary file ITR for the past 2 years and avoid notices/legal actions etc.

Dept has to follow procedure of notice and cannot take direct action

You can file for FY 20-21,21-22 AND 22-23

FY 22-23 should be priority for filing as last date is 31.12.2023 with nominal late fees. Other 2 years can be filed in coming 3 months.
